// Licensed to the .NET Foundation under one or more agreements. // The .NET Foundation licenses this file to you under the MIT license. using System; using System.Diagnostics; using Internal.Text; using Internal.TypeSystem; namespace ILCompiler.DependencyAnalysis { [Flags] public enum AssociatedDataFlags : byte { None = 0, HasUnboxingStubTarget = 1, } /// <summary> /// This node contains any custom data that we'd like to associated with a method. The unwind info of the method /// will have a reloc to this custom data if it exists. Not all methods need custom data to be emitted. /// This custom data excludes gcinfo and ehinfo (they are written by ObjectWriter during obj file emission). /// </summary> public class MethodAssociatedDataNode : ObjectNode, ISymbolDefinitionNode { private IMethodNode _methodNode; public MethodAssociatedDataNode(IMethodNode methodNode) { Debug.Assert(!methodNode.Method.IsAbstract); Debug.Assert(methodNode.Method.GetCanonMethodTarget(CanonicalFormKind.Specific) == methodNode.Method); _methodNode = methodNode; } protected override string GetName(NodeFactory factory) => this.GetMangledName(factory.NameMangler); public override ObjectNodeSection GetSection(NodeFactory factory) => ObjectNodeSection.ReadOnlyDataSection; public override bool StaticDependenciesAreComputed => true; public int Offset => 0; public override bool IsShareable => _methodNode.Method is InstantiatedMethod || EETypeNode.IsTypeNodeShareable(_methodNode.Method.OwningType); public override int ClassCode => 1055183914; public override int CompareToImpl(ISortableNode other, CompilerComparer comparer) { return comparer.Compare(_methodNode, ((MethodAssociatedDataNode)other)._methodNode); } public virtual void AppendMangledName(NameMangler nameMangler, Utf8StringBuilder sb) { sb.Append("_associatedData_"u8).Append(nameMangler.GetMangledMethodName(_methodNode.Method)); } public static bool MethodHasAssociatedData(IMethodNode methodNode) { // Instantiating unboxing stubs. We need to store their non-unboxing target pointer (looked up by runtime) ISpecialUnboxThunkNode unboxThunk = methodNode as ISpecialUnboxThunkNode; if (unboxThunk != null && unboxThunk.IsSpecialUnboxingThunk) return true; return false; } public override ObjectData GetData(NodeFactory factory, bool relocsOnly) { Debug.Assert(MethodHasAssociatedData(_methodNode)); ObjectDataBuilder objData = new ObjectDataBuilder(factory, relocsOnly); objData.RequireInitialAlignment(1); objData.AddSymbol(this); AssociatedDataFlags flags = AssociatedDataFlags.None; var flagsReservation = objData.ReserveByte(); ISpecialUnboxThunkNode unboxThunkNode = _methodNode as ISpecialUnboxThunkNode; if (unboxThunkNode != null && unboxThunkNode.IsSpecialUnboxingThunk) { flags |= AssociatedDataFlags.HasUnboxingStubTarget; objData.EmitReloc(unboxThunkNode.GetUnboxingThunkTarget(factory), RelocType.IMAGE_REL_BASED_RELPTR32); } objData.EmitByte(flagsReservation, (byte)flags); return objData.ToObjectData(); } } }
